嵌入式系统的内存管理方法和内存管理装置

    公开(公告)号:CN119645641A

    公开(公告)日:2025-03-18

    申请号:CN202411728340.6

    申请日:2024-11-28

    Abstract: 本发明提供了一种嵌入式系统的内存管理方法和内存管理装置,方法包括:将RAM中一段连续的地址空间指定为动态内存空间;当接收到功能模块的内存空间申请请求时,识别应用程序中是否包括资源文件;如果包含,获取动态内存空间的第一剩余内存空间容量,并判断第一内存空间容量是否小于或等于第一剩余内存空间容量;如果是,将对象数据集存储至动态内存空间;基于对象数据集在动态内存空间中的内存地址生成第一空间分配数据,并记录至资源文件,以更新资源管理数据;并将内存地址返回给功能模块。该方式中,通过将对象数据集存储至动态内存空间并记录空间分配数据,可以对内存分配情况进行实时更新和跟踪,从而提高内存利用率和运行稳定性。

    应用下载方法、装置、智能卡及介质

    公开(公告)号:CN119645522A

    公开(公告)日:2025-03-18

    申请号:CN202411728698.9

    申请日:2024-11-28

    Abstract: 本申请涉及智能卡操作系统技术领域,公开了一种应用下载方法、装置、智能卡及介质,该方法包括获取目标应用工程,在flash区域内为目标应用工程分配地址;对目标应用工程进行编译得到对应可执行文件;基于目标应用工程的起始地址、标识信息和应用方法结构体构建应用模块参数结构体,并进行编译,将编译后的应用模块参数结构体置入可执行文件;接收外部设备发送的应用脚本,执行应用脚本中的指令,并创建应用模块目录;基于目标应用工程的起始地址获取应用模块参数结构体,基于应用方法结构体安装目标应用,并将目标应用的安装数据存储在目标应用目录下。通过本申请方法可知实现智能卡应用后下载。

Patent Agency Ranking